Specifications
Frequency Stability: ±10ppm
Current - Supply (Disable) (Max): 31mA
Height - Seated (Max): 0.032" (0.80mm)
Size / Dimension: 0.126" L x 0.098" W (3.20mm x 2.50mm)
Package / Case: 4-SMD, No Lead
Mounting Type: Surface Mount
Ratings: --
Current - Supply (Max): 33mA
Operating Temperature: -40°C ~ 85°C
Absolute Pull Range (APR): --
Series: SiT8208
Voltage - Supply: 3.3V
Output: LVCMOS, LVTTL
Function: Enable/Disable
Frequency: 3.57MHz
Type: XO (Standard)
Base Resonator: MEMS
Part Status: Active
Packaging: Tape & Reel (TR)
